Keep Your Eye on the Ball (Life)!
“I have been crucified with Christ. It is no longer I who live, but Christ who lives in me. And the life I now live in the flesh I live by faith in the Son of God, who loved me and gave himself for me.” Galatians 2:20
Over the years I have tried to pound this verse into my head and into my life. The Lord has been showing me that I was going about this verse all wrong. My focus was about trying to die instead of living. This was exhausting and led to more bondage. One can’t get to living by trying to die. For example, when trying to learn how to hit a baseball my coach always said, “look at the ball (life) and strike it.” My coach never said, “Stop looking at the players in the field.” That would be foolish; it would lead to a very low chance of hitting the ball. We arrive where we look. Look to Christ. It is in His living, that we find life. (more…)
